This side-by-side compares ZIP 48103 (Ann Arbor, MI) and ZIP 48104 (Ann Arbor, MI) using the same Census ACS 5-Year table fields for both — no averages swapped in, no national proxies. ZIP 48103 has a population of 53,057 at 315 people per square mile, while ZIP 48104 has 38,315 at 1,902 per square mile. That difference in population size and density alone reshapes how every other metric should be interpreted — a higher-income ZIP with 1,200 residents behaves very differently from one with 45,000.

On income and education, ZIP 48103 reports a median household income of $116,194 against $64,231 in ZIP 48104, with per-capita income of $69,131 vs $52,000. The share of adults holding a bachelor's degree or higher is 75.3% in 48103 and 80.9% in 48104. Poverty rate reads 8.4% vs 36.3%, and unemployment 2.2% vs 5.1% — these four fields alone drive most of the difference in the scorecard grades you will see for each ZIP.

Housing separates these two ZIPs further: median home value sits at $471,700 in 48103 versus $491,200 in 48104, with median rent of $1,810 and $1,639 per month respectively. Homeownership rate is 66.5% vs 36.9%.
